Social Networking 201 - Social Graces - Lesson1 Humility
When social networking, as in life, we feel it's all about us. It's our show. We are number one. That is great self-esteem. However not such a great social grace.
Because most people feel everything is about them, they want YOU to feel that too. They want you to be interested in them, because, it's their show, not yours.
So here we are faced with a conundrum, How do we present ourselves firstly to ourselves, to friends, to people, and to the networking community with humility, but also be able to attract?
I'll briefly talk about Alpha Male/Female and Sociopaths. Alphas attract people automatically with their strong air of confidence, ability, charm, intelligence etc. Everyone wants to be an alpha or go out with an alpha. However, sometimes alphas unwittingly forget about how to care about others therefore becoming a sociopath. Sociopaths lack the ability to feel true emotion, are parasites in nature and quickly dump anyone who is of no use to their survival.
As an aspiring/estabilished alpha it is important to maintain your humanity with humility. Alphas are obvious and they don't need to sprout about their achievements. But to fully leverage the alpha power you need to take interest in others. I know you probably don't have time to care, and you probably really don't care anyway, but you must look like you care. You must act like you care. Take some lessons from the sociopath in this regard. They are geniuses in faking care.
Send those birthday greetings (time consuming but cheaper than buying a lead), comment on someones photo, remark on their status, play a game and LOSE to someone.
Almost impossible for an alpha but try to OK, it's important to make others FEEL more important to you even though, frankly, they are not. Don't go all humanitarian on me now and lovey dovey about saving the world and really caring about others, because we are in business here people, save the niceties for your spare time. I say it as it is.
You want to be the star of your own show. As we ALL do. There's the rub. There are millions of shows going on all the time. The trick to dominating social networking and thus becoming the alpha is to pretend and interact with all the other shows going on and start writing reviews on what you see.
